Big Game (2014)
A Finnish teenager and the US President make an unlikely survival team after Air Force One is downed over the Nordic wilderness.

Big Game - Plot
Air Force One is shot down by terrorists, leaving the President of the United States stranded in the wilderness of Finland. 13-year-old Oskari is on a hunting mission to prove his maturity to his kinsfolk by tracking down a deer, but instead discovers the President in an escape pod. With the terrorists closing in to capture their prize, the unlikely duo team up to escape their hunters.

Big Game - FAQs
What is Big Game about?
Big Game follows a 13-year-old Finnish boy named Oskari who stumbles upon the President of the United States after Air Force One is shot down by terrorists over the Finnish wilderness. The unlikely pair must work together to outsmart the terrorists closing in on them and survive the rugged terrain.
Who plays the President in Big Game?
Samuel L. Jackson plays President William Alan Moore in Big Game. His character escapes Air Force One in a pod and is discovered by young Oskari, played by Onni Tommila. The chemistry between the seasoned action star and the young Finnish actor is one of the film's highlights.
Who are the main actors in Big Game?
The cast is led by Samuel L. Jackson as the US President and Onni Tommila as Oskari, the resourceful Finnish teenager. They're joined by Ray Stevenson, Victor Garber, Felicity Huffman, Jim Broadbent, Ted Levine, Mehmet Kurtuluş, Jorma Tommila, and Risto Salmi.
Is Big Game based on a true story?
No, Big Game is not based on a true story. It's an original action-adventure screenplay written and directed by Finnish filmmaker Jalmari Helander. The premise — Air Force One being shot down over Finland and the President being rescued by a young boy — is entirely fictional.

Who directed Big Game and where was it filmed?
Big Game was directed by Finnish filmmaker Jalmari Helander, who also wrote the screenplay. The film was primarily shot in Finland and Germany, making great use of the stunning Nordic wilderness landscapes that give the movie its distinctive visual atmosphere and sense of rugged, cold-weather adventure.
